I've been using SilverFast SE for a couple of years now, with a Microtek ScanMaker 6400XL (SCSI interface). I recently sold that scanner, because my new PowerMac G5 is PCI-X based and doesn't take the SCSI card, and I bought a new ScanMaker 9800XL.
Now, I see that SilverFast Ai supports the 9800XL, even under Panther. But the most recent Microtek model in this line that SilverFast SE supports is the 9600XL.
Why is this? Is there support for the 9800XL planned? I suspect the 9600XL version will work, but I'd like to get the official word on it before I buy the upgrade.

Dear Mr. Tiemann.
We balance the amount of effort and money well before we decide wether to develop a SE version for the scanner or not. The 9800XL is considered to be a professional scanner which means there is no SE support planned. You may want to contact sales@silverfast.de and ask for a cross upgrade.
Kind regards.
